The retailer
pricing of DJ Hero found recently -- $120 bucks! -- has some folks wondering why Activision may have upped the price for its usual game-plus-peripheral combo. The company has offered an explanation answer to
Eurogamer, saying, "We believe that
DJ Hero will provide tremendous value for our consumers by delivering an all-new interactive music experience with over 100 individual songs that are highlighted in over 80 unique mixes, a wide variety of ..."
...
Sorry, we nodded off there for a minute. Between the
$250 for The Beatles: Rock Band and another $120 for
Tony Hawk: Ride, we're up late a lot, worrying about affording all these plastic game controllers -- and a bigger house to put them all in.
